The light gallery and Tennyson Schad
Firstly I would like to declare my coi im the son in law of the late Tennyson schad, I am hoping to find someone from the project who is intersted in helping me to document a significant gap in the history of 20th-century photography: the Light Gallery (1971–1987) and its founder Tennyson Schad.
while many of the artists who showed at the gallery have significant pages , the founder Tennyson Schad or tbe gallery itself do not.
Ive identified some key notability Archives: The 279-archive collection is held at the Center for Creative Photography (CCP). Scholarly Review: Subject of the 2020 CCP exhibition "The Qualities of LIGHT" and the documentary "LIGHT: When Photography Was Undiscovered" by Lisa Immordino Vreeland. Legal Significance: Tennyson Schad’s role as a copyright attorney who helped bridge the gap between commercial photography and fine art law.
